Real estate brokers play a crucial position in determining the market value of houses. Understanding how they assess property value involves numerous components, methodologies, and careful evaluation. Home market value isn't merely a quantity; it reflects what a buyer is keen to pay in a given market at a specific time.

A primary technique for determining home market value is thru comparable sales evaluation. This technique includes looking at lately offered properties which are related in size, location, and options to the home being evaluated. Agents gather information about these comparable homes, sometimes called "comps," to gauge the price range that potential patrons might discover interesting.

When analyzing comparables, agents contemplate various elements of every property. These can include the square footage, variety of bedrooms and bogs, age of the property, and unique features. The extra carefully aligned the comps are with the subject property, the more correct the valuation is more probably to be.


Local market conditions additionally considerably influence how real estate agents decide market value. For occasion, if there’s a excessive demand for homes in a particular area, sellers might price their properties greater. Conversely, in a buyer’s market the place inventory exceeds demand, properties could also be priced extra competitively. Analyzing present market trends helps agents establish a worth that displays the neighborhood's demand and pricing behavior.




The condition of the house performs a vital role in its market value. This consists of each the inside and exterior condition, in addition to any upgrades or renovations which have been accomplished. A home that has been well-maintained or recently remodeled will typically command a better value than one requiring important repairs. Agents will carefully inspect the property, noting areas that may increase or scale back its total value.


Neighborhood components additionally contribute to a home's market value. Agents will assess the quality of local faculties, security information, proximity to facilities, and total neighborhood options. Properties in fascinating neighborhoods with excellent schools or parks typically see higher valuations. Understanding the nuances of the neighborhood can be pivotal in pricing decisions.

Economic elements, similar to rates of interest and the general economic climate, also play a big role. Low-interest rates often attract more buyers, thereby rising competitors and driving up home costs. Conversely, in a rising rate of interest setting, the buying energy of consumers might decrease, impacting home valuations negatively. Agents must stay vigilant about these developments to information their pricing successfully.

The use of technology and data analytics has become increasingly prevalent in real estate valuations. Agents usually leverage a quantity of itemizing providers (MLS) and online tools to entry complete knowledge on current sales, price developments, and even neighborhood statistics. This technology permits brokers to shortly gather pertinent data, streamlining the valuation course of.


In addition to these quantitative factors, agents also incorporate qualitative assessments when determining home market value. This can contain private impressions, unique selling points, and the emotional enchantment of a property. Homes with compelling options, similar to stunning vistas or historic charm, could warrant a premium worth despite being less comparable on paper.

Collaboration with appraisers can even help real estate agents in their pricing technique. Appraisers present skilled assessments of a property's value based on objective standards. By aligning their evaluations with an appraiser's insights, brokers can establish a more dependable worth range for clients.

While all these factors are important in figuring out market value, communication with shoppers is equally important. Real estate brokers must effectively relay the rationale behind the proposed value to make sure that sellers are comfy and informed (Affordable Family Homes For Sale In Longmont). This transparency fosters belief and permits shoppers to have realistic expectations all through the selling course of


Competition among agents can create various methods for pricing homes. Some could undertake an aggressive pricing strategy to attract extra potential consumers, while others might lean toward conservative pricing to make sure a quick sale. Each agent’s unique method impacts how they arrive at a home’s market value, shaping their recommendations for sellers.

How do comparable gross sales affect home market value?


Comparable gross sales, or "comps," are just lately sold properties similar in size, location, and features to the home in question. Agents analyze these sales to know what consumers are prepared to pay, serving to to ascertain a fair market value.


What position does home situation play in market value determination?


The situation of a house considerably impacts its market value. Well-maintained properties are typically valued larger, whereas properties needing repairs may be priced decrease. Factors embody the state of main techniques like plumbing, roofing, and home equipment.
